- Develop, integrate, and document structural and interior payload system requirements to establish comprehensive system designs.
- Utilize 3-D Computer-Aided Design (CAD) tools to create, maintain, and modify structural and interior payload system and component designs, providing detailed product definitions to engineering teams, production operations, suppliers, and external customers throughout the product lifecycle.
- Perform and integrate analytical and test results to validate and verify that systems and components meet all specified requirements.
- Manage supplier development, testing, and production activities, coordinating closely to optimize designs and achieve program goals.
- Innovate new design and analysis processes and tools to enhance the effectiveness, quality, and efficiency of development efforts.
- Investigate emerging technologies to develop concepts for future product designs, meeting projected requirements.
Our Payloads organization is responsible for everything you see when you fly—and much that you don't. This includes the aircraft's interior, cargo compartments, exterior markings, associated systems, and cabin safety features. We enable our airline customers to fulfill their missions and represent their brands effectively. Our fast-paced, dynamic environment draws from diverse engineering backgrounds, offering a comprehensive statement of work that spans the product lifecycle. This includes supporting customer configuration development, supplier engagement, validating and verifying design requirements, integrating business needs, and supporting the product through production and certification processes. Your work will involve interfacing with project engineering, production engineering, program/product management, and more.
